The treatment of an aqueous solution of3.74 gofCuNO32with excessKIresults in a brown solution along with the formation of a precipitate. PassingH2Sthrough this brown solution gives another precipitateX. The amount ofX(ing) is____[Given: Atomic mass ofH=1, N=14, O=16, S=32, K=39, Cu=63, I=127]

Answer:
0.32
Solution:

Number of moles of CuNO32=3.74187=0.02

2CuNO32+4KICu2I2+I2+4KNO3

Number of moles of Cu2l2 precipitated =0.01

I2brown solution+H2SS+2HI

Number of moles of S precipitated =0.01

Mass of S precipitates =0.01×32g=0.32 g
